How much does it cost to rent an apartment in St-Elphège?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| St-Elphège Studio Apartments | $1,423 | $200 | $1,700 |
| St-Elphège 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,763 | $975 | $2,420 |
| St-Elphège 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,303 | $1,600 | $3,585 |
| St-Elphège 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,208 | $1,795 | $5,842 |
| St-Elphège 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,897 | $3,800 | $3,995 |
